I don't think he is. laxman was very easy on the ways, and a superb crisis player - in 2011, he saved/won us 4 matches from precarious positions. he is very underrated, although he did have his share of weaknesses against the moving ball. in contrast, vihari seems better suited against moving ball but not short-pitched deliveries. I think he is more of a solid player who puts a price on his wicket and chugs along steadily - more like pujara than laxman, who was a virtuoso with the bat.
